Ex-Lionhead Dev Speculates About Fable 4

With the Fable franchise on hiatus since the death of Fable Legends, hope for another installment has arisen as Don Williamson, former Lead Engine Programmer at the now-defunct Lionhead Studios has given us something quite interesting to think about:

“Mmm ok, having no inside information, I totally know who’s building Fable 4 now. Interesting choice…” – Don Williamson (@Donzanoid)

Williamson has since deleted the tweet and noted that he has no insider information regarding any ongoing project at Microsoft, but his follow-up tweets implied that development of Fable 4 would be ongoing with a developer in the UK:

A major possible candidate at this point would be Microsoft’s own Playground Games, which has been scouting for a senior game designer that will “join the team and the project at an early stage, giving you the rare opportunity to shape the future of an exciting, large-scale open world action / RPG AAA title from the outset.”

Whilst nothing has been confirmed, it’s interesting to think that Microsoft may possibly be returning to the franchise in the near future. Until then, unfortunately, all we can do is speculate.
